A woman has completed her third London Marathon - despite having pins in her back to straighten a curved spine. Claire Nicholson, 24, developed the curve in 2011 and at just 13 had surgery to fix her spine which was shaped like an S. She was forced to wear a back brace throughout her early schooling years. But she didn't let it stop her doing what her peer group could do and she has prospered in running after years of training. She has since run three marathons - including on Sunday. Claire, from Bishops Stortford, Hertfordshire, said: "My back is completely inflexible but I've suffered no side effects or pain from my condition. "My spine makes me unique and I feel so happy that I've run my third marathon - against all the odds."
